How to store cart items in localstorage

WebApr 10, 2024 · You have to save the state of your application using vuex and localStorage API, As changes are made to your shopping cart, you use your app state and that persists your data to the localStorage. On reload, vuex will pick the data from the localStorage using the data that was last stored there. Here is how that would work in your vuex store: WebMar 1, 2016 · Supporting @konijn point - if you want to store price in localStorage, ensure that you have server side logic to override price and other sensitive cart item details to avoid hacks there. Try showing up overridden price to user as well ( by syncning with server ) when you user is about to pay.

javascript - How to save the status of the shopping cart after the …

WebNov 1, 2024 · To do this, we need to parse the string. //javascript let newObject = window.localStorage.getItem("myObject"); console.log(JSON.parse(newObject)); Here, we … Web[1:01] One caveat with localStorage is we need to store it as a string. The first thing we're going to do is we're going to create a new constant called data. We're going to set that … shappell wide house https://myshadalin.com

How to use Local Storage in Javascript with an example

WebMar 14, 2024 · To see the local storage in the browser: Open Dev Tools go to > Application and on the left sidebar select Local Storage. Adding products to the cart Now that we have our products in the local storage let's see how we can target them and put them in the cart list. We are gonna first set some global variables so we don't repeat our self. WebApr 21, 2024 · Today you will learn to create Local Storage Shopping App using JavaScript. Basically, there are 3 products with image and title, quantity box, add to cart button in the … WebSep 19, 2024 · Use the setItem() function to store an item in LocalStorage. This function takes a key as its first argument and a value as the second argument. As mentioned … pooh rabbit ears

JavaScript localStorage - javatpoint

Category:How do I store a simple cart using localStorage?

Tags:How to store cart items in localstorage

How to store cart items in localstorage

javascript - localStorage functions for website shopping …

WebBest Answer storeInLocalStorage(item, keyAndvalue) { var data = localStorage .getItem ( 'item' ); data = data ? JSON .parse (data) : []; data.push (keyAndValue); localStorage .setItem (item, JSON .stringify (data)); } Note that keyAndvalue should be an array as well and not already a json string. WebAug 26, 2024 · Build A Basic Shopping Cart #. To build our shopping cart, we first create an HTML page with a simple cart to show items, and a simple form to add or edit the basket. …

How to store cart items in localstorage

Did you know?

WebThe localStorage object stores data with no expiration date. The data is not deleted when the browser is closed, and are available for future sessions. See Also: The sessionStorage …

WebAug 26, 2024 · Build A Basic Shopping Cart #. To build our shopping cart, we first create an HTML page with a simple cart to show items, and a simple form to add or edit the basket. Then, we add HTML web storage to it, followed by JavaScript coding. Although we are using HTML5 local storage tags, all steps are identical to those of HTML5 session storage and ... WebHow to persist the shopping cart state to local storage-----For those who don't know, I'm a full stack web developer who has been in the industry for ...

WebWe'll learn how to set up a simple example using React state, using an onClick handler to update that state, and using localStorage to store and retrieve the value. Show more Show more... WebFeb 22, 2024 · How to Use the setItem () Method By giving values to a key, this technique is used to store objects in localStorage. This value can be of any datatype, including text, integer, object, array, and so on. It is vital to remember that in order to store data in localStorage, you must first stringify it with the JSON.stringify () function.

WebMar 18, 2024 · This has led me to consider using the localStorage api to persist the cart. The other option is to go with the tried and true store the cart in a database temporarily and tie this to the user via cookie in the browser. In terms of browser support, localStorage sports browser support of IE8 and up. This is more than sufficient.

WebFeb 20, 2024 · cart.items contains the current items in the cart. This is simply an object that has the format of PRODUCT ID : QUANTITY. iURL is the URL to the product image folder. currency and total The currency symbol and the total amount of items in the cart. 3B) WORKING WITH LOCALSTORAGE cart.js shappell wide house 6500 ice fishing shelterWebMar 20, 2024 · Local storage shopping cart. Insert, update, remove products from the browser's local storage. - YouTube 0:00 / 9:50 Local storage shopping cart. Insert, update, remove products... shappell tow barWebFeb 22, 2024 · How to Use the setItem () Method By giving values to a key, this technique is used to store objects in localStorage. This value can be of any datatype, including text, … shappel minecraftWebTo retrieve the user cart simply cast the session back to a new instance of the model class: var newCart = (CartModel)Session [“UserCart”]. Session is a quick and easy method to store unsecured information as it disposes of itself and becomes inaccessible to the user once they have closed their browser. shapphire foxx edWebI was hoping I could store all the data in the 'cart' object in localStorage by storing the product ids, names, prices and quantities and then reflecting this in a 'cart' div within the … pooh rainWebYou probably already have some cart in your webshop. You only need to make it possible to link it to a session id (or a key that you store in a cookie) instead of an actual user. This way you only need to develop it once. And an anonymous user can be a logged in user 5 seconds later. It is a breeze to link the cart to the logged in user. shappell wh5500iWebJan 28, 2024 · use localStorage.setItem (myItmes, 'xyz') to store and localStorage.getItem (myItmes) to get them back, note that you need to parse your results using JSON.parse () … shappell wide house 6500 stores